Spanish Government Debates Centralization of Emergency Services After Devastating August Wildfires

Following Spain's August wildfires, Interior Minister Grande-Marlaska defends a proposed State Civil Protection Agency, despite opposition from regional governments and coalition partners who fear recentralization, while the PP criticizes the government's response.

100% Mortgages: Access, Costs, and Requirements

Spanish banks are offering 100% mortgages, eliminating the need for a down payment, but these come with higher costs and stricter requirements for borrowers.

Spain and UK End Gibraltar Dispute, Focus on Ukraine and Gaza

Spanish Prime Minister Pedro Sánchez visited UK Prime Minister Keir Starmer in London, marking the first such visit in seven years and signifying the end of a long-standing Gibraltar dispute, as both countries focus on the conflicts in Ukraine and Gaza.

Scottish Rapist Fakes Death, Builds New Life in Spain

James Clacher, a Scottish man under investigation for two rapes, faked his death in 2022, assumed a new identity as "Johnny Wilson" in Nerja, Spain, and lived there undetected for almost two years before being apprehended.

Telefónica to Leave New York Stock Exchange After 40 Years

Telefónica, Spain's first company listed on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E), plans to delist its shares after 40 years, simplifying its structure and reducing regulatory burdens; the company will continue trading in Madrid and São Paulo.

German Pensioner Retains Benefits Despite Spanish Murder Conviction

A German man, convicted of double murder in Spain, retains his pension due to a lack of conviction in a German court, despite the severity of his crimes and arguments that his actions violated fundamental human rights.

Spain Shatters Tourism Records Despite Backlash and Climate Concerns

Spain welcomed a record 11 million international visitors in July 2025, exceeding previous monthly totals and bringing the year's total to 55.5 million, generating over €76 billion in tourist spending despite anti-tourism protests and wildfires.
